Overview:

Madison Energy Investments (“MEI”) believes in the power of clean energy infrastructure and has quickly emerged as a preeminent developer, investor, asset owner, and operator of distributed generation. This role represents a critical next step in MEI’s evolution toward offering direct, end-to-end services to Fortune 500 corporates, public entities, nonprofits, and other private customers alike.

The Procurement Manager will play a crucial role at MEI as the logistics expert who will specialize in implementing cost-effective purchases and ensure quality control. This role has a unique opportunity to work and lead across all MEIs project phases and is responsible for the procurement of goods for use in the business by identifying potential supplier sources, screening them, negotiating favorable payment terms; monitoring supplier performance and ensuring contractual obligations are met.

What You’ll Be Doing:

Creating and implementing procurement strategies that are innovative, cost effective and incorporate the growing complexities and challenges within the industry.

Building long-term relationships with vendors in the industry.

Procuring material that includes solar PV modules, inverters, racking, battery storage equipment, switchgear, and other electrical equipment.

Coordinating with Engineering and Construction teams to ensure both scope (Technical Specifications) and project timeliness are met.

Reviewing contract specifications on behalf of the company; working closely with the legal department to ensure contracts and terms are favorable.

Engaging in continuous improvement initiatives surrounding the areas of quality, risk mitigation and supply chain.

Develop and maintain scorecards of supplier performance and recommend new suppliers based on quality, competitive pricing and service.
